The question is why are these people under attack if the scientific community is truly interested in open dialogue?

"Open dialog" means intelligent dialog, not stupid arguments by people who don't know what they're talking about. It doesn't include:

> arguments from personal incredulity (that wipes out the entire of "intelligent design")

> God-of-the-gaps arguments ("evolution can't answer question X, therefore God must have done it")

> unsupported "what-ifs" (What if the speed of light changed? What if radioactive decay rates change?)

> "you weren't there, so you can't prove what happened" arguments.

That pretty much wipes out every creationist argument there is.
